KATHMANDU, Sept 5: Agitating nurses have agreed to return to work after they reached a 10-point deal with the government on Friday evening.


They reached the agreement at talks held at the Ministry of Health and Population. Nursing Association of Nepal (NAN), the umbrella organization of nurses across the country, had halted all services except the emergency ones in all government hospitals and health posts, to press the government meet its demands.



Among others, the association has demanded a raise in salary and allowances, more amenities for them, better working environment and amendment to nursing policy.
